Film: "May I Be Frank"

Location: Arthur Zankel Music Center

Date: 11/14/2010

Time: 7:00 PM - 9:00 PM

Speaker: Frank Ferrante & Conor Gaffney

Description:
"May I Be Frank", an independent film about "sex, drugs and transformation" documents the transformation of Frank Ferrante's life. Frank is 54 years old, obese, depressed and addicted. He stumbles into a local raw, organic and vegan restaurant in San Francisco, Café Gratitude. When Ryland, a server at Café Gratitude asks Frank, "What is one thing you want to do before you die?" Frank replies, "I want to fall in love one more time, but no one will love me looking the way I do." Ryland, his brother Cary, and Conor, his best friend, are inspired by the possibility of helping Frank. For the next 42 days, Frank will eat only raw food, practice gratitude, visit local holistic practitioners, and get a weekly colonic. Ryland, Conor, and Cary get to support Frank's miraculous transformation. Frank gets a new body, a clearer mind, and most importantly, a soaring spirit. "May I Be Frank" documents the essence of the human condition and what it truly means to fall in love again.

The film has been endorsed by Alice Walker, Woody Harrelson, and Jason Mraz, among many others, and continues to open hearts and move to tears everywhere it is screened. It has been recognized and won awards at film festivals across the U.S. including the Awareness, Green Lifestyle, Kountze, Real to Reel, Saulsalito and Topanga Film Festivals.

After the screening, Frank Ferrante and Conor Gaffney, one of the filmmakers, will be discussing the film and answering any questions the audience may have.
